Abstract:
An approach is provided for tracking personal items. A triggering event associated with tracking a personal item is detected via a bearer tag coupled to the personal item. Sensing of the bearer tag is initiated in response to the detection of the triggering event. A determination of whether location of the personal item satisfies a predetermined criterion is made. A notification is generated if the criterion is satisfied.
Abstract:
A method is provided for warning mobile users of traffic conditions. One or more sensor messages are monitored from a plurality of mobile devices transported by a plurality of vehicles. A traffic condition is determined based on the one or more sensor messages. Location of the traffic condition is also determined based on position information of one or more of the plurality of mobile devices. The mobile devices that are within a predetermined proximity to the location of the traffic condition are selected. An alert message is generated in response to the traffic condition. The selected mobile devices are notified with the alert message.
Abstract:
An approach is provided for auto-completion functions. Textual input is received from a user via an application, a profile metadata is retrieved based on the textual input, a script is generated based on the profile metadata, and the script is transmitted to the application, wherein the script provides auto-completion of information corresponding to the textual input using the profile metadata.
Abstract:
A system and method for providing a unified messaging and modeling infrastructure (UMMI) is disclosed. The system may comprise an input module of a first operations support system configured to receive information for processing at the first operations support system and a processor module of the first operations support system configured to process the information received at the first input module and an output module of the first operations support system configured to transmit a standardized data sheet to the second operations support system. The system may comprise an input module of the second operations support system configured to receive the standardized data sheet and a processor module of the second operations support system configured to update the standardized data sheet based on processing operations at the second operations support system and to generate executable code to support interface functionality based on definitions of the standardized data sheet.
Abstract:
A content processing device is configured to receive a media stream via a network. The media stream may be analyzed to detect whether an anomaly is present in the media stream indicative of a potential quality defect in playback of the media stream. Data relating to a detected anomaly may be provided to a destination via the network.
Abstract:
User imaging terminals (such as mobile phones with camera or video functionality) may be used to take images that are used to create an image stream of an event. In one implementation, a device may receive the images and transmit the images to one or more second users. The device may receive indications, from the second users, of whether the images are approved by the second users for incorporation into an image stream; and generate the image stream, based on the images that are approved by the second users. The image stream may be transmitted to one or more display devices.
Abstract:
An approach for permitting an unregistered user of a mobile device to utilize a communication service. It is detected that a user of a mobile device is not registered with a service provider to utilize the mobile device. Authentication information supplied by the user of the mobile device is collected. A request, including the authentication information, is generated for using a communication service of the service provider. In response to the request, an acknowledgement message is selectively received granting permission for the user to utilize the communication service if the authentication information is valid.
Abstract:
An exemplary system includes an access management facility and a message processing facility communicatively coupled to the access management facility. The access management facility is configured to generate and activate an access code, and initiate providing of the access code to a potential message source. The message processing facility is configured to receive an incoming message, determine whether the incoming message includes the access code, deliver the incoming message to a user if the incoming message is determined to include the access code, and not deliver the incoming message to the user if the incoming message is determined not to include the access code. In certain implementations, the access code is used in conjunction with a set of authorized message sources for selectively filtering the incoming message. In certain implementations, at least one tool is provided, the tool being configured to enable the user to manage the access code.
Abstract:
Embodiments of the invention provide systems and methods for determining an escalation level including receiving one or more requests to join a communication session associated with a situation, identifying information associated with one or more participants that is associated with the one or more requests, determining an escalation level associated with the situation based at least in part on the information associated with the one or more participants, notifying the one or more participants the escalation level associated with the situation and allowing the communication session associated with the situation to filter a participants list and/or communications based on information associated with one or more participants.
Abstract:
A non-transitory computer-readable medium comprising instructions executable by at least one processor, the instructions to cause the at least one processor to bill a subscriber, enrolled in a multi-tiered pricing plan, a plan fee associated with the multi-tiered pricing plan, for each billing cycle of a plurality of billing cycles, for services associated with a subscriber device; track, for each billing cycle, an amount of usage of the services; determine, for each billing cycle, a pricing tier corresponding to the tracked usage; and bill the subscriber, for each billing cycle, a fee associated with the corresponding pricing tier, wherein at least two of the corresponding pricing tiers differ.